Output 7a943f02d33cbaf8d1bde46e6272c6fd034525456415dd034a8e993717226fdd:1

value
123156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c2ef6536f7518bcf2096d8e560947e65798181 OP_EQUAL
address
3HMCzgFiBkhTtHeszo2i72pj58Exbokt5n
transaction
7a943f02d33cbaf8d1bde46e6272c6fd034525456415dd034a8e993717226fdd
confirmations
239757
spent
true